Cornelian Cherry ( Cornus Mas L. ) Berries: Methods of Bioactive Potential Preserving By Suhodol Natalia, Viorica Cazac, Eugenia Covaliov, Olga Gutium & Coralia Babcenco Technical University of Moldova Abstract- It is known that cornelian cherry is among the best natural remedies for the human body. For those who do not have access the berries when they are harvested, they can turn to cornelian cherry only as dried fruit. The dried cornelian cherry can be found in the stalls or in stores with organic products. In this sense, the aim of the current research is study how different methods of preserving cornelian cherry berries influence on their bioactive potential in terms of total phenolic content and antioxidant activity. The paper presents the effect of drying and freezing on the bioactive potential of cornelian cherry berries. Keywords: cornelian cherry, drying, freezing, phenolic content, antioxidant activity.
